`

用PHP实现 上一篇、下一篇的代码

    博客分类:
  • php
 
阅读更多

主页是index.php;传递的值是id(数据库的主键);文章的数据库是article,其中文章标题的列是title

代码:

<?php 
//----显示上一篇、下一篇文章代码 START---- 

$sql_former = "select * from article where id<$id order by id desc "; //上一篇文章sql语句。注意是倒序,因为返回结果集时只用了第一篇文章,而不是最后一篇文章 
$sql_later = "select * from article where id>$id "; //下一篇文章sql语句 
$queryset_former = mysql_query($sql_former); //执行sql语句 
if(mysql_num_rows($queryset_former)){ //返回记录数,并判断是否为真,以此为依据显示结果 
$result = mysql_fetch_array($queryset_former); 
echo "上一篇 <a href='index.php?id=$result[id]'> ". $result[title]." </a><br>"; 
} else {echo "上一篇 没有了<br>";} 

$queryset_later = mysql_query($sql_later); 
if(mysql_num_rows($queryset_later)){ 
$result = mysql_fetch_array($queryset_later); 
echo "下一篇 <a href='index.php?id=$result[id]'> ". $result['title']."</a><br>"; 
} else {echo "下一篇 没有了<br>";} 
?> 

 

分享到:
评论

相关推荐

    get实现上一篇下一篇文章插件 for Phpcms2008.rar

    标题中的"get实现上一篇下一篇文章插件 for Phpcms2008.rar"指的是一个专为Phpcms2008内容管理系统设计的插件,该插件使用GET方法来获取并展示文章的上一篇和下一篇文章。在网页内容展示中,这种功能常见于博客或者...

    phpweb文章上一篇下一篇

    - 附带的说明文档可能包含了如何正确替换文件、更新数据库查询、修改模板代码等步骤,确保正确实现上一篇/下一篇功能。 7. 安全性: - 在处理文章链接和显示时,需对用户输入进行过滤和转义,防止XSS攻击。 - 对...

    php 上一篇,下一篇文章实现代码与原理说明

    PHP实现上一篇和下一篇文章的功能主要涉及到对数据库的查询操作,其基本原理是根据文章的ID字段进行排序,然后选取与当前文章ID相邻的记录。具体实现时,通常需要以下几个步骤: 首先,需要设计一个文章存储的...

    PHP实现上一篇下一篇的方法实例总结

    以上内容总结了PHP实现上一篇、下一篇功能的主要方法,包括SQL查询技巧和PHP代码实现。在实际应用中,需要考虑数据库优化、防止SQL注入等安全问题,以确保系统的稳定性和安全性。同时,随着技术的发展,现在的开发更...

    yii2实现 上一篇,下一篇 功能的代码实例

    在Yii2框架中,实现“上一篇”和“下一篇”的功能是常见的需求,尤其是在构建文章管理系统时。这个功能主要是为了方便用户浏览相邻的文章,提供更好的用户体验。以下将详细解释提供的代码实例及其工作原理。 首先,...

    Wordpress中上一篇与下一篇功能代码

    在WordPress中,上一篇与下一篇功能是用于在文章之间创建导航链接的重要工具,方便用户浏览网站内容。这两个功能可以通过内置的PHP函数`previous_post_link()`和`next_post_link()`实现。下面将详细介绍这两个函数...

    yii2实现 "上一篇,下一篇" 功能的代码实例

    在Yii2框架中,实现“上一篇”和“下一篇”的功能是常见的需求,尤其是在内容管理系统或者博客系统中。这个功能允许用户在文章列表之间轻松导航。以下是一个详细的代码实例,展示了如何在Yii2中实现这一功能。 首先...

    WordPress中上一篇与下一篇功能代码

    本文实例讲述了Wordpress中上一篇与下一篇功能代码。分享给大家供大家参考。具体如下: 很多WordPress给文章加上一篇下一篇这个功能,代码如下写法: 复制代码代码如下:&lt;?php previous_post_link(‘%link’); ?&gt...

    php秒杀实现代码

    本篇文章将深入探讨如何使用PHP和Redis来实现一个高效的秒杀系统,这对于初学者来说是一个非常实用的学习案例。 首先,我们要了解秒杀系统的基本要求:高并发处理、数据一致性以及防止恶意刷单。Redis作为一个内存...

    帝国CMS内容页调用上一篇与下一篇方法汇总

    例如,你可以使用以下代码来调用上一篇文章和下一篇文章: ```html [!--news.url--]e/public/GotoNext?classid=[!--classid--]&id=[!--id--]&enews=pre"&gt;上一篇 [!--news.url--]e/public/GotoNext?classid=[!--...

    php代码实现二级联动下拉菜单效果

    本篇文章将详细介绍如何使用PHP来实现二级联动下拉菜单的效果。 首先,我们要理解二级联动的基本概念。它是指当用户在一个下拉菜单中选择一个选项时,另一个相关的下拉菜单会根据用户的选择动态地更新其选项。这...

    thinkphp实现上一篇与下一篇的方法

    本文实例讲述了thinkphp实现上一篇与下一篇的方法。分享给大家供大家参考。具体实现方法如下: 方法一: 复制代码 代码如下: //上一篇  $front=$Article-&gt;where(“id&lt;“.$id)-&gt;order(‘id desc’)-&gt;limit(‘1’)...

    PHPWE图片photo模块 上一篇下一篇插件定制

    在这个特定的场景中,我们关注的是PHPWE图片photo模块的“上一篇下一篇”插件定制。这个插件是为了解决在浏览图片时,用户能够方便地在图片之间进行导航,类似于文章列表中的“上一篇”和“下一篇”功能。 首先,让...

    网博士PHPWEb图片photo模块 上一篇下一篇插件定制.rar

    对于PHPWeb系统的管理员来说,通过这个插件可以方便地管理和展示网站的图片内容,尤其是利用“上一篇”、“下一篇”功能,可以为访客提供流畅的图片浏览体验。同时,根据文档进行操作可以确保插件功能的正常发挥,...

    用php实现图片滚动

    根据提供的描述,“在PHP中可能会想到要实现一个图片滚动的程序,此程序可以提供这样的功能”,我们可以推断出本篇文章的目标是介绍如何利用PHP(尽管实际代码使用的是JavaScript与HTML)来创建一个图片滚动效果。...

    phpcms手机内容页面添加上一篇和下一篇

    为了实现这一功能,我们需要对PHP CMS的核心文件进行一些操作,包括添加代码段来查询数据库并获取上一篇或下一篇的内容信息。具体来说,我们将会在`wap/index.php`文件中进行操作,这是PHP CMS为移动页面提供的核心...

Global site tag (gtag.js) - Google Analytics